55 Favorite Games That Teach Good Behavior to Children

By: Lawrence Shapiro


This book contains 55 of Dr. Shapiro’s favorite games for teaching children to respect rules, be more cooperative with adults, and become more caring people. The games take just 10-15 minutes to play, and they are so much fun that children want to play them again and again. A great way to help children develop their emotional, social and behavioral skills through their natural language of play.
